Definitions and Meaning of wetter in English

wetter noun

  1. someone suffering from enuresis; someone who urinates while asleep in bed
  2. a workman who wets the work in a manufacturing process
  3. a chemical agent capable of reducing the surface tension of a liquid in which it is dissolved
